          B.S. In Sustainable Urban Environments

          • Brooklyn, USA

          BSc

          English

          Cities play a critical role in addressing the environmental challenges that face the world today. The major in Sustainable Urban Environments prepares students to make cities more sustainable. Students gain an understanding of the social and technical issues in urban environmental problems, and an appreciation of the policy and planning approaches that are necessary to create more livable, sustainable, and equitable cities.

          An urban planning program can be an excellent way for students to learn all about the management of a city’s growth. It might include a wide variety of subjects ranging from zoning ordinances to economic development along with public policy, civil engineering, and funding requirements.

          American English is extremely dominant in the USA, so classes will likely be in English, with a few exceptions. This means that many schools will ask for proof of English proficiency through the TOEFL iBT test before admitting international students.
